Position: StarRocks Data Engineer / Platform Engineer
Location: Austin, TX & Sunnyvale, CA (Remote)
Project Type: Full-Time
StarRocks DB Exprience Must
Job Description
We are looking for an experienced StarRocks Data Engineer / Platform Engineer to design, implement, and optimize high-performance analytics platforms using StarRocks. The ideal candidate should have strong expertise in distributed databases, data warehousing, real-time analytics, and cloud-native technologies.
Key Responsibilities
- Design, deploy, and manage StarRocks clusters for large-scale analytical workloads.
- Build and optimize real-time and batch data ingestion pipelines.
- Develop scalable data models to support business intelligence and analytics requirements.
- Monitor, troubleshoot, and tune StarRocks performance for high concurrency and low-latency queries.
- Integrate StarRocks with cloud platforms, data lakes, and streaming technologies.
- Collaborate with data engineering, analytics, and platform teams to deliver robust data solutions.
- Implement security, backup, disaster recovery, and governance best practices.
- Support production environments and resolve performance bottlenecks.
Required Skills
- 7–9 years of experience in Data Engineering, Big Data, or Database Engineering.
- Hands-on experience with StarRocks database administration, deployment, and performance tuning.
- Strong knowledge of distributed OLAP databases and data warehousing concepts.
- Experience with SQL optimization and query performance analysis.
- Expertise in ETL/ELT frameworks and data pipeline development.
- Experience with cloud platforms (AWS, Google Cloud Platform, or Azure).
- Strong understanding of Linux administration and distributed systems.
- Experience with container technologies such as Docker and Kubernetes.
- Knowledge of data integration tools and streaming platforms such as Kafka, Spark, or Flink.
Preferred Skills
- Experience with modern data lake architectures (Iceberg, Hudi, Delta Lake).
- Exposure to BI and reporting tools such as Tableau, Power BI, or Looker.
- Experience with Infrastructure as Code (Terraform, CloudFormation).
- Knowledge of Python, Java, or Scala.
- Experience in multi-cloud environments and large-scale analytics platforms.
Education
- Bachelor’s or master’s degree in computer science, Information Technology, Engineering, or a related field.
